December in Medak, India brings a pleasant climate, characterized by a maximum temperature of 31°C (87°F) and an average temperature hovering around 22°C (72°F). The month offers a refreshing respite from the heat, with a minimum temperature dipping to 11°C (52°F), perfect for cozy evenings. Precipitation is minimal, with only 7 mm (0.3 in) of rain falling across just one day, ensuring that the lush greenery remains vibrant. The humidity level sits comfortably at 77%, adding a touch of moisture to the crisp winter air, making December an inviting time to explore this charming region.

In December, Medak, India experiences a notable drop in precipitation, receiving only 7 mm (0.3 in) over the course of just 1 day. This represents a significant decline from the heavy rains of the monsoon months, where June through September saw substantial rainfall exceeding 153 mm, with July peaking at 204 mm. As the year draws to a close, the transition from the wet season is evident, with November's rainfall also tapering to 15 mm. This trend marks a shift to drier conditions, heralding the cooler, more stable climate of winter, as Medak prepares for the dry season ahead.
In Medak, India, December brings a noticeable drop in humidity compared to the peak months of late monsoon. After a steady rise from 36% in March to a high of 86% in September, the humidity levels begin to moderate. By December, humidity stabilizes at 77%, providing a refreshing contrast to the preceding months, particularly October and November, which hover around the 83%-85% range. This slight decline indicates a shift in the climatic rhythm as the year draws to a close, suggesting a more balanced atmosphere that enhances the crispness of the air and the charm of the winter season.
In Medak, India, the UV Index reveals a clear trend of intensifying sun exposure from January through July, where values peak at a striking 15 in July. This signifies an extreme risk, with a burn time of just 10 minutes during the height of summer. As the year progresses into the cooler months, the UV Index gradually decreases, dropping to 8 in December, indicating a very high exposure category with a slightly extended burn time of 15 minutes. As December settles in Medak, the wind whispers gently through the region, with an average speed of 2.0 m/s (4 mph), mirroring the tranquility of January and April. This subtle breeze offers a delightful contrast to the more robust winds experienced in the summer months of June and July, which peak at 3.5 m/s (8 mph) and 3.6 m/s (8 mph), respectively. The trend throughout the year reveals a gradual increase in wind speeds during the monsoon season, culminating in May’s lively 2.9 m/s (6 mph) before tapering off again in the cooler months.
